Funny Story
I have a funny story for you, but I need to preface it. As I have said I teach this AP Calculus class. First semester was pretty rough. I had two parent-teacher conferences before break, and two after. I have had two kids drop and three kids want to drop. For the three that want to drop, they are suppose to be making an effort to do well. If they give it their all and still find themselves lost, then they can drop the class before midterms come out. I had this one pt conference before break that was horrible. I felt like a horrible teacher and the parents pretty much told me that. I found out there was a "personality conflict" between the two of us and I didn't know we had any issues there. She told her parents last year if I was teaching Calc instead of the teacher from last year then she didn't want to take Calculus. The parents were pretty adament about her dropping. The counselor struck up the agreement above. This girl promised her parents she would try, but I think she assumed it wouldn't work. Funny thing is it did work. She has been coming to me for help, paying attention, working hard on assignments, and now she understands the material. So in class on Friday she was all upset that she actually understands the math and is doing well because her goal was to get out of my class. Funny isn't it!
